Excellent opportunity for an experienced Infrastructure Engineer with strong SAN and VMware experience to join a growing team within a large, multi-site environment. This role will suit someone who enjoys working with enterprise storage, on-prem infrastructure, building systems from scratch and playing a key role in project delivery rather than purely BAU support.
This organisation is a well-established UK business operating across secure and highly regulated environments, with a significant national presence. They are investing in their infrastructure team, adding engineers to support growth and ongoing improvements across a large estate of over 90 sites and 1,000+ servers.
In this role, you will be responsible for delivering infrastructure projects and supporting core systems across a predominantly on-prem environment. A major focus of the position is managing and supporting SAN / enterprise storage platforms, alongside VMware virtual infrastructure, Active Directory and wider server technologies. Around 80% of the role is project-based, giving you the opportunity to be involved in real upgrades, migrations and improvement work across the business.
The ideal candidate will have strong experience in enterprise infrastructure environments, particularly with SAN / storage platforms, VMware and on-prem systems. You will be comfortable working across physical and virtual environments, have solid Active Directory experience, and ideally some exposure to cloud technologies.

The Role:
- Support, administer and optimise SAN / enterprise storage environments
- Manage VMware infrastructure including hosts, clusters, datastores and performance
- Deliver infrastructure projects across 90+ sites (approx. 80% project work)
- Build, install and configure servers and infrastructure from the ground up
- Support and maintain Active Directory and core Microsoft environments
- Assist with cloud and hybrid infrastructure where required
- Carry out firmware upgrades, patching and lifecycle management
- Ensure systems are secure, stable and operating effectively
The Person:
- Strong hands-on infrastructure experience in an enterprise environment
- Proven SAN / storage experience (key requirement)
- Strong VMware administration experience
- Solid Active Directory experience
- Exposure to cloud platforms such as Azure or AWS beneficial
- Experience with physical servers, racks and on-prem environments
- Full UK driving licence
- Able to obtain SC clearance
